Lansdale's New Assistant Borough Manager Begins Duties
The borough now has additional manpower to take on new projects.

LANSDALE, PA -- Lansdale’s newest Assistant Borough Manager has begun his duties.
John J. Ernst began his work on January 1.
“Lansdale is very well-regarded for the range and quality of services we provide to our community and we continually work to improve our performance and streamline operations,” Lansdale Borough Manager Jake Ziegler said in a press release. “John’s experience with Lansdale has given him extensive understanding of municipal operations, making him a perfect fit for this new role. I’m delighted to have a proven leader on our team.”

After a year of shovels hitting the ground on various projects and an expected influx of more, Borough management realized a need for additional management staff. The Assistant Manager position allows Ziegler to focus on long-range issues while Ernst assists in supervision of municipal departments and employees while continuing his current duties as Director of Community & Economic Development, the position he has held since 2010.
“Over the past six years John has shown his loyalty, intelligence and a strong work ethic,” said Council President Denton Burnell when asked about Ernst’s new role. “John has learned how the entire Borough operates, he knows all the employees and has the respect of both employees and our citizens.”

This position marks the continuation of Ernst’s established career in public service and his strong track record complements Lansdale’s commitment to building a healthy, vibrant community dedicated to the service of its citizens. John, a Temple graduate with over twenty years of experience in the Architectural field, has lived in the Borough with his family for the past twenty-five years and is ready for this new venture.
“Lansdale is a very well-run Borough with a lot of exciting initiatives underway so it’s truly an honor to be selected for this position,” stated Ernst. “This is a great community with wonderful opportunities on the horizon and I look forward to being a part of the team that continues to move us forward.”
